151280P.pdf 06/24/2016 Laura Julin v. Carolyn W. Colvin
U.S. Court of Appeals Case No: 15-1280
U.S. District Court for the Southern District of Iowa - Davenport
[PUBLISHED] [Colloton, Author, with Murphy and Benton, Circuit Judges
Civil case - Social Security. The ALJ did not err in discrediting
claimant's allegations of disabling impairments based on the record
presented; nor did the ALJ err in weighing the medical evidence, or in
refusing to give controlling weight to her treating physician's conclusory
opinions concerning her ability to work full time and her workplace
limitations; there was substantial evidence to support the ALJ's
conclusions regarding claimant's residual functional capacity.
